Ovechkin is coming off a historic two-goal performance against the Blackhawks at Capital One Arena. A hat trick goal would have broken Gretzky's record, but he didn't want to score No. 895 on an empty net. That means hockey fans everywhere will be tuned in to watch Ovechkin and the Caps take on the Islanders.
WASHINGTON (7News) — On Sunday, the Washington Capitals will face the New York Islanders on the road. Alex Ovechkin is currently tied with Wayne Gretzky as the NHL's all-time leading goal scorer. Now, he could stake his claim as the league's top scorer if he lights the lamps against New York.
